The Majestic Mogao Caves: Dunhuang
Venture into the heart of the Silk Road and marvel at the Mogao Caves, a UNESCO World Heritage site. These breathtaking caves conceal over 492 intricate grottoes adorned with exquisite Buddhist murals and sculptures. The Forbidden City: Beijing
Step into the heart of imperial China at the Forbidden City, a magnificent UNESCO World Heritage site. Explore the sprawling palaces, courtyards, and gardens that once housed the emperors of the Ming and Qing dynasties. The Terracotta Army: Xi'an
Uncover the secrets of the Terracotta Army, one of the greatest archaeological discoveries of all time. Visit the Mausoleum of the First Qin Emperor and marvel at thousands of life-sized terracotta warriors standing in formation. Learn about the intricacies of ancient Chinese warfare and history.
The Longmen Grottoes: Luoyang
Explore the Longmen Grottoes, another UNESCO World Heritage site with over 100,000 Buddhist sculptures carved into towering cliffs. Wander through the numerous caves, admiring the intricate carvings and sculptures that depict stories from the life of Buddha.
